PURE Insurance Championship
The Pure Insurance Championship provides First Tee participants a national stage on which to showcase the skills and values they’ve learned at their local chapter. Throughout this week Margaret Kerr, Emma Poffinbarger and Victoria Routzong were able to network with peers, PGA Tour Champions players and leaders from the business world competing in the amateur field.
Our chapter made history with Margaret Kerr being the first FTGH participant to win the Pro/Jr event! Margaret and her partner, Steven Alker, made a great par on the final hole securing the one-shot victory. Congratulations to our outstanding girls on an amazing week at Pebble Beach!

Congratulations to Jazmine Harris on completing her ACE Certification with First Tee – Greater Houston!
ACE Certification is the highest level a participant can achieve in the First Tee program. It recognizes advanced leadership, personal growth, and life skills development — preparing young people for success both on and off the golf course. Earning this certification is no small feat and reflects years of Jazmine's hard work, perseverance, and impact in the community.
Jazmine also served as a Summer Intern at Memorial Park, traveled to Atlanta to attend the First Tee Leadership Academy, and now attends the University of Houston, majoring in Hospitality. In her spare time, she continues to give back by working at our Law Park facility, mentoring the next generation of participants.
Jazmine, your dedication and passion for making a difference truly shine through. We’re incredibly proud of you and can’t wait to see what’s next!

How does it work? The Angel Tree program is a holiday gift drive that connects donors with children in need. Each “angel” represents a child, and donors can “adopt” an angel to provide gifts like clothing and toys based on the child’s wish list.
To participate, you can sign up in-person at F. M. Law Park or Memorial Park, after which you'll receive an email with your angel's details—such as age, clothing sizes, and gift wishes!
If you're interested in adopting and you attend class at Battleground, Bayou, Gus Wortham, Quail Valley, or Sharpstown, you'll need to email your Program staff directly to sign-up.

First Tee – Greater Houston is launching its very first Junior Advisory Board (JAB), a crew of teens ages 14–18 who will help shape what’s next for our programs and community impact! These future leaders will represent their peers, share ideas, and make sure our initiatives truly reflect what matters most to juniors and teens.
JAB will run like a student council—members will elect their own leaders, collaborate on projects, and bring fresh energy to everything we do. It’s all about building character, amplifying youth voices, and making a difference in Greater Houston!

Big Things Are Coming to F. M. Law Park
F. M. Law Park is where it all began for so many kids throughout Houston—and after years of play, it’s time to refresh! Spanning 2,473 yards of natural turf, Houston’s only nine-hole municipal golf club for kids serves as a free, safe space for thousands of First Tee students and their families each year.
Thanks to supporters like you, we’ve already reached one-third of our $6M goal! This campaign will bring much-needed upgrades, including renovated buildings and kid-friendly recreational areas, improved irrigation and drainage, and totally renovated course, driving range, and practice areas.
